An adverse drug reaction is an unintended response to a medication that occurs at normal doses and can range from mild to life-threatening. For carbamazepine, this can include skin reactions, rashes, and serious conditions like Stevens-Johnson syndrome. Documenting timing, dosage, and symptoms helps determine if the drug contributed to injury.
The statute of limitations sets a deadline for filing a claim after an injury becomes known or should have been discovered. In California, these deadlines vary by case type and defendant. Missing the deadline can bar recovery, so timely consultation with a qualified professional is important to preserve rights.
A settlement is an agreement between the parties to resolve claims without a trial. Settlements can provide compensation for medical costs and damages while offering privacy and speed, but they may also require releases that limit future rights. Stevens-Johnson syndrome (SJS) represents a severe and potentially life-threatening condition that impacts the skin and mucous membranes. When this condition progresses to its most dangerous variant, toxic epidermal necrolysis (TEN), mortality rates can range from 30-80%. In most cases, these reactions stem from adverse responses to pharmaceutical medications.
